Masayuki Chuma is a scholar working on Oncology, Epidemiology and Infectious Diseases. According to data from OpenAlex, Masayuki Chuma has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 522 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Oncology, 10 papers in Epidemiology and 9 papers in Infectious Diseases. Recurrent topics in Masayuki Chuma's work include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(8 papers),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(7 papers) and Biomedical Ethics and Regulation (6 papers). Masayuki Chuma is often cited by papers focused on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(8 papers),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(7 papers) and Biomedical Ethics and Regulation (6 papers). Masayuki Chuma coll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Taiwan. Masayuki Chuma's co-authors include Yoshito Zamami, Keisuke Ishizawa, Mitsuhiro Goda, Kenshi Takechi, Naoto Okada, Takahiro Niimura, Masaki Imanishi, Kenta Yagi, Hirofumi Hamano and Yuki Izawa‐Ishizawa and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inical Infectious Diseases, Scientific Reports and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
